I am a sociologist primarily interested in social conceptualizations of disability in developing countries as they relate to contextual influences such as HIV/AIDS. My most recent research explores teachers' beliefs about d/Deafness in the context of HIV/AIDS education in Kenyan schools for the deaf.  These findings argue that these varied beliefs support models of deafness as both culture and disability depending on teachers' personal experiences and attitudes that in turn influence how they approach, implement and reflect upon the HIV/AIDS education curriculum.
